Bugs and bats and bears – oh my! The diversity of species that call the Flathead River Valley home ranges from the microscopic to the larger-than-life. Last summer, Wildsight and the rest of the Flathead Wild team headed out into the field to survey this incredible biodiversity as part of the fourth annual Flathead BioBlitz.

Join us on January 19th at TELUS World of Science in Vancouver to hear about the bioblitz, learn about some of the research being done in the Flathead from the Royal BC Museum’s Claudia Copley and Darren Copley, and find out how you can protect and conserve the Flathead Valley – some of the best remaining wilderness in Southern B.C.!
